Chip Monolithic Ceramic Capacitors
High Frequency for Flow/Reflow Soldering
s Features
1. HiQ and low ESR at VHF, UHF, Microwave.
2. Feature improvement, low power consumption for
mobile telecommunication. (Base station, terminal,
etc.)
s Applications
High-frequency circuit (Mobile telecommunication, etc.)
